Resumo

Over the recent decade, the method of radiofrequency ablation has been increasingly used for treatment of thyroid nodules. However, there is clear need for additional morphological experimental works on evaluating the effectiveness of application of different devices. This work presents results of investigation of an original device operating on the principle of bipolar radiofrequency ablation, and its high effectiveness in eliminating thyroid nodules with different consistencies and malignancy potentials has been proven, which offers broad prospects for introducing the patented radiofrequency-ablation applicator into practice, alongside other methods of minimally invasive surgery.
